Account Number for Specific Programs
The account number is necessary for enrolling into TRACS. It links you to the account that you wish to access.

Alberta Indian Tax Exemption (AITE)
The account number is the nine-digit business identification number (BIN) found on correspondence issued by TRA. If you are a first-time filer, the BIN is mentioned in your registration approval letter. Do not include the suffix. (e.g., 15-001).
Corporate Income Tax (CIT)
The account number is the nine- or ten-digit corporate account number (CAN) found on the correspondence issued by TRA. It is also noted on your notice of assessment/reassessment and statement of account.
Fuel tax collectors/remitters
The account number is the nine-digit business identification number (BIN) found on correspondence issued by TRA. If you are a first-time filer, the BIN is mentioned in your registration approval letter. It is also noted on your notice of assessment/reassessment and statement of account.
International Fuel Tax Agreement (IFTA)
The account number is the business identification number (BIN) on your IFTA licence and on any correspondence from TRA regarding your account. Enter the account number without the prefix "AB".
Locomotive fuel use
The account number is the nine-digit business identification number (BIN) found on correspondence issued by TRA. It is also noted on your notice of assessment/reassessment and statement of account.
Prescribed Rebate Off-road Percentages (PROP)
The account number is the business identification number (BIN) found on field one of the Prescribed Rebate Off-road Percentages (PROP) Application (AT277) when filing by paper or online when filing through the Internet. If you are a first-time filer, the BIN is mentioned in your registration letter.
Propane retailers
The account number is the nine-digit business identification number (BIN) found on correspondence issued by TRA. If you are a first-time filer, the BIN is mentioned in your registration letter. Do not include the suffix "000".
Tax Exempt Fuel Sales (TEFS)
The account number is the business identification number (BIN) found on correspondence issued by TRA. Do not include the suffix "000".
Tax Exempt Fuel User (TEFU)
The account number is the nine-digit business identification number (BIN) found on your registration letter or field four of the Renewal Application form (AT324).
Tobacco tax collectors
The account number is the nine-digit business identification number (BIN) found on correspondence issued by TRA. If you are a first-time filer, the BIN is mentioned in your registration approval letter. It is also noted on your notice of assessment/reassessment and statement of account.
Tourism levy
The account number is the business identification number (BIN) found on field nine of the tourism levy return (AT317). It is also noted on your notice of assessment/reassessment and statement of account. If you are a first-time filer, the BIN is the first nine digits mentioned in your registration letter.
